5
A
回答
0
聯網的PRBS模式通常使用Linear Feedback Shift Registers來完成。也許用軟件模擬其中的一種就足夠了。
2
我不確定是否有符合您目的的圖書館。我可以給你一些關於執行的指導,但是:
你實現的基礎是LFSR。可以實現以下兩種方式之一:
- 斐波那契實現由其中二進制加權抽頭的模2之和被反饋到輸入端的簡單移位寄存器的(記住,模2之和爲相當於沒有進位的加法,這反過來等同於XOR)。
- 伽羅瓦的實現由一個移位寄存器組成,其內容在每個步驟都由輸出級的二進制加權值修改,同樣使用模2數學。伽羅瓦權重的順序與斐波那契權重的順序相反。由於反饋環路中邏輯量的減少,伽羅瓦形式通常更快。
有關如何指定水龍頭和您可以獲得什麼序列的更多信息,您可以開始here。請注意,上面的實現選擇可以具有相同的週期長度和輸出位序列,以便適當選擇初始狀態(種子)。
這是您的基本要求。 LFSR具有非常均勻分佈且足夠長的輸出流。我建議不要將它用於加密目的,因爲它非常弱 - 是一個線性系統。有解決方法,但除了shrinking generator(我覺得非常酷)沒有任何實質性的東西。
實現鏈接已經給出,所以祝你好運!
0
這是一個在koders.com
相關問題
- 1. 需要在SQL中生成新模式
- 2. PRBS發生器模塊中的VHDL
- 3. 後端僅需要生成RESTful API嗎?
- 4. XSL:如何根據需要生成正則表達式模式?
- 5. API調用以XML形式生成數據,需要它爲JSON
- 6. 模板生成不需要的鏈接
- 7. 需要爲以下xml生成XSD模式?
- 8. 生成散列的特定模式需要幫助
- 9. 爲ASP.Net Web API生成JSON模式
- 10. PDF生成幫助需要
- 11. 需要動態生成列
- 12. Scala中的「call-cc」模式?
- 13. Json模式 - oneOf字段需要需要
- 14. Drupal的形式API需要
- 15. 需要正則表達式來匹配用戶生成的模式
- 16. 需要JSON模式屬性
- 17. C#生成器需要以編程方式格式化文件
- 18. 製作Sable CC解析器生成器
- 19. PHP谷歌聯繫API生成HTTP/1.0 401需要授權
- 20. 需要Java API來生成數據庫ER圖
- 21. 如何生成此模式
- 22. 集成測試 - 此操作需要IIS集成管道模式
- 23. 生成Java類JSON模式
- 24. 使php-mode(和其他cc模式派生模式)與Emacs兼容23
- 25. 需要爲隨機生成的密碼生成正則表達式
- 26. TypeScript,Mongoose,Jasmine - 需要模式
- 27. 需要PHP preg模式
- 28. C#Regex.replace模式需要
- 29. 需要基於模式YYYYMMDD
- 30. 生成器設計模式:爲什麼我們需要一個Director?